**Runbook: Spokewise rebalancer — plugin hooks**

If your plugin wants to veto a rebalancing run (say, a street festival near Dock 12), register a `pre_dispatch` hook and return a reason string. Spokewise logs it and skips the van route. Don't throw exceptions — that kills the whole planner, not just your dock. When filing issues, include the planner's trace token, which is printed below.

build token for hadup-kagag: htk3_a67

From Petra Louvelle to incoming director Johan Raske. The reseller programme covers forty-one active partners across the Dalbreck and Soreno regions. Tier criteria were revised last spring; three partners remain on legacy terms until year end and should be handled carefully. Quarterly rebate reviews are owed to the top tier in six weeks. Sales leads have current pipeline files. One sensitive matter affects programme direction, and the confidential plan is set out just below.

management briefing: Project Ulavan slips by two quarters because of the staffing delay.

## Quillbox Environments

Welcome aboard. Quillbox places a bloom filter in front of the Hollis key-value store to avoid pointless disk lookups for absent keys. Each environment (dev, staging, prod) sizes the filter differently, so false-positive rates vary—do not copy settings between tiers. The staging environment currently runs with the configuration shown below.

config for haweg-bagag:
[kasath]
host = kasath.qirvancorp.internal
user = kasath_svc
database = kasath_prod